Abstract
A method of stress compensation in a display includes converting a stress profile for a slice of the display from a first format to a second format based on a conversion ratio; transforming the converted stress profile for the slice of the display, with a first transformation, to form a compressed transformed stress profile; decompressing the compressed transformed stress profile to form a decompressed transformed stress profile; and transforming the decompressed transformed stress profile, with a second transformation, to form a decompressed stress profile, the second transformation being an inverse of the first transformation.
